GC–MS fingerprint of Pogostemon cablin in China
Journal of Pharmaceutical and Biomedical Analysis, 2006Pogostemon cablin, originating in Malaysia and India, is cultivated in southern China including Guangdong and Hainan Province, which was called GuangHuoXiang to differentiate it from the HuoXiang of the north, the species Agastache rugosa, that it resembles. Antimutagenic Activity of Flavonoids from Pogostemon cablin
Journal of Agricultural and Food Chemistry, 2000A methanol extract from Pogostemon cablin showed a suppressive effect on umu gene expression of SOS response in Salmonella typhimurium TA1535/pSK1002 against the mutagen 2-(2-furyl)-3-(5-nitro-2-furyl)acrylamide (furylfuramide). The methanol extract was re-extracted with hexane, dichloromethane, butanol, and water.

Four new sesquiterpenes from the stems of Pogostemon cablin
Fitoterapia, 2013Four new sesquiterpenes (1-4), together with four known compounds (5-8), were isolated from the stems of Pogostemon cablin (Blanco.) Benth. Their chemical structures were elucidated by means of spectroscopic methods, including 1D and 2D NMR, HRESIMS, IR, and UV.
